The Alcohol and Drug Abuse Counseling Certificate program aligns with California's certification standards for substance abuse counselors. Approved by the CA Foundation for Advancement of Addiction Professionals (CAADAC's educational arm), this curriculum may not fulfill certification criteria in other states.
